I don't think the Panthers would. They've (the fans) been pretty vocal about Ekblad being irreplaceable in their line up. Marner and his contract doesn't get Ekblad and I am not sure what player would.

It certainly wouldn't make Florida better. They would be spending a lot more money to be a worse team. They have nothing that could come remotely close to filling the hole in their roster moving Ekblad would create.

Before losing Dadonov and Hoffman, the Panthers scored at about the same clip that the Leafs did, so going out and adding offence wasn't likely on their To-Do list, though the exits of the aforementioned might have changed that.

It does when the top 4 are all forwards.

The other problem...itsthat way for the next 4 years. It be easier if it was staggard where one per year contract was ending so they could transfer cap to defense.

You should limit your F space to under 60% of the cap unless you have 1-2 yr flexibility with having some lower cost players on D filling higher roles.

We have a lot of NHL ready cheap contracts on their ELC or coming off their ELC on forward and defence:

Forwards: Korshkov Anderson Hallander Engvall Mikheyev Robertson

Defence: Sandin Liljegren Lehtonen Dermott Holl

Plus we have found out that Toronto is a placed where some players want to play for cheap: Simmonds Thornton Spezza etc.

Rielly is the only contract remaining to sign in a couple years with Brodie and Muzzin locked up.

If the Leafs can exploit all this then we should be fine filling out the roster.
